php怎么更深入学习
-
要更深入地学习PHP,以下是一些建议和方法:
1. 深入了解PHP语言特性和基础知识
– 学习PHP的语法规则、数据类型和运算符等基础知识。
– 熟悉PHP的面向对象编程(OOP)特性,并学习如何使用类、对象、继承和多态。
– 深入理解PHP的函数和命名空间,学习如何使用和创建自定义函数和命名空间。2. 学习PHP的高级特性和扩展
– 深入理解PHP的异常处理机制,并学习如何使用try-catch语句来处理异常情况。
– 学习如何使用PHP的文件操作和数据库操作扩展,如文件读写、数据库连接和查询等。
– 研究PHP的正则表达式特性,学习如何使用正则表达式进行字符串匹配和替换。3. 掌握PHP的框架和库
– 学习常用的PHP框架,如Laravel、Symfony和CodeIgniter等。了解它们的特点、用法和优缺点,能够使用框架进行快速开发。
– 掌握PHP常用的库和组件,如Smarty模板引擎、PHPUnit测试框架和PHPExcel电子表格库等。了解它们的功能和用法,能够将它们应用到实际项目中。4. 深入研究PHP的性能优化和安全性
– 学习如何优化PHP的性能,包括减少数据库查询次数、优化代码结构和缓存数据等。
– 学习PHP的安全性问题,了解常见的安全漏洞和攻击方式,掌握防范措施,如输入验证和数据过滤等。5. 参与开源项目和社区
– 参与PHP开源项目的开发和贡献,通过实际项目的参与,深入理解PHP的应用和熟悉PHP的最新发展动态。
– 加入PHP相关的社区和论坛,与其他PHP开发者交流经验和分享知识,拓宽自己的视野。总之,要更深入地学习PHP,需要掌握其基础知识和高级特性,熟悉常用框架和库,深入研究性能优化和安全性问题,并积极参与开源项目和社区。通过不断学习和实践,不断提升自己的PHP技能水平。
2年前 -
学习PHP的深入方法
PHP是一种广泛使用的服务器端脚本语言,用于开发动态网站和应用程序。如果你想更深入地学习PHP,以下是五个方法可以帮助你提高你的技能和知识:
1. 阅读权威的PHP文档和教程:
PHP官方网站提供了详细的文档和教程,这是一个学习PHP的良好起点。官方文档详细解释了每个功能和语法的用法和工作原理。此外,还有一些优秀的PHP教程和书籍可以帮助你更好地理解和掌握PHP的概念和技术。2. 实践编写PHP代码:
理论知识是很重要的,但是要想真正掌握PHP,就需要实际动手写代码。通过编写实际的项目和练习示例,你可以加深对PHP语法和功能的理解,并提高解决问题和调试错误的能力。你可以尝试编写简单的脚本、小型网站或应用程序来提高自己的编程技巧。3. 学习PHP框架:
PHP框架是一种简化和加速开发的工具。学习和使用流行的PHP框架,如Laravel、Symfony和CodeIgniter等,可以帮助你更快地构建复杂的Web应用程序,并提高代码的可维护性和可重用性。学习框架的过程中,你可以了解到更高级的概念和开发技巧,这对于深入理解PHP编程是很有帮助的。4. 探索PHP生态系统:
PHP生态系统非常庞大,有许多有用的工具、库和扩展可供使用。了解并掌握这些工具可以提高你的开发效率和代码质量。例如,学习数据库操作和ORM(对象关系映射)工具可以帮助你更好地处理数据;学习测试工具和调试技术可以提高代码的质量和可靠性。可以通过查阅文档、阅读源代码、参与开源项目等方式深入了解PHP生态系统。5. 参与社区和交流:
PHP拥有一个活跃和友好的开发者社区,加入其中可以与其他开发者交流经验、解决问题、获取反馈和分享知识。参与PHP相关的论坛、博客和社交媒体群体,参加本地和在线活动,与其他开发者进行合作和协作,这些都是提高自己技能和知识的强大资源。总结起来,要更深入地学习PHP,你需要阅读官方文档和教程,通过实践编写代码来巩固知识,学习并使用PHP框架和工具,深入探索PHP生态系统,并参与PHP开发者社区和交流。通过这些方法,你可以扩展自己对PHP的理解和技能,成为一个更优秀的PHP开发者。
2年前 -
要深入学习PHP,可以按照以下步骤进行:
1. 学习基本语法和特性
PHP是一种通用的脚本语言,特别适用于Web开发。作为一门基础语言,首先要掌握它的基本语法和特性,包括变量的定义和操作、数据类型、运算符、控制流程语句等。可以参考PHP官方网站(www.php.net)上的文档或者相应的教程书籍。2. 理解面向对象编程(OOP)
PHP支持面向对象编程(OOP),这是一种重要的编程范式。通过学习OOP,你可以更好地组织和管理你的代码,提高代码的可维护性和复用性。需要熟悉类、对象、继承、接口、多态等概念,并学会如何在PHP中实现它们。3. 掌握常用的PHP库和框架
PHP有许多优秀的库和框架可以加速开发过程。学习常用的PHP库和框架,例如MySQL数据库操作库、图片处理库、表单验证库等。并深入了解一或两个流行的PHP框架,如Laravel、Symfony、CodeIgniter等,它们可以帮助你更快地构建复杂的Web应用程序。4. 学习数据库操作
在Web开发中,数据库是必不可少的一部分。学习如何使用PHP操作数据库,包括连接数据库、执行SQL语句、数据的增删改查等。常用的数据库有MySQL、SQLite、PostgreSQL等,你需要学会使用它们的PHP扩展库来操作数据库。5. 熟悉常用的Web开发技术
除了PHP语言本身,还需要熟悉一些常用的Web开发技术,如HTML、CSS、JavaScript、AJAX等。HTML用于定义网页结构,CSS用于美化网页样式,JavaScript用于实现动态效果,AJAX用于异步数据交互。学习这些技术,可以使你的PHP应用程序更加丰富和交互性。6. 实践项目
深入学习PHP最好的方式是进行实际项目开发。可以选择一些小型项目,例如个人博客、电子商务网站、论坛等。通过实践,你可以将之前学到的知识应用到实际中,同时也会遇到各种问题和挑战,进一步提升自己的技能。总之,要深入学习PHP,需要不断地学习和实践。通过掌握基本语法、理解面向对象编程、熟悉常用的库和框架、学习数据库操作和常用的Web开发技术,结合实际项目的实践,你将能够更深入地掌握PHP,并在Web开发领域中获得更高的技术水平。
2年前